Overview

Proinsulin II-GAD mRNA lipid particle aggregates is an experimental immunotherapeutic vaccine candidate designed for the prevention or delay of type 1 diabetes (T1D). It consists of mRNA encoding two key beta-cell autoantigens, proinsulin II (PI2) and glutamic acid decarboxylase (GAD), encapsulated within anionic lipid particle aggregates (LPAs). The mechanism involves the delivery of these autoantigens to the immune system in a manner that promotes immune tolerance and suppresses the autoimmune destruction of insulin-producing beta cells. In preclinical studies using non-obese diabetic (NOD) mice, the combination of PI2 and GAD mRNA-LPAs demonstrated superior efficacy in delaying the onset of diabetes compared to single-antigen formulations, particularly at the 18-week mark.
